Docusate calcium price?

Docusate calcium is available at a range of prices depending on the dosage, formulation, and whether it is a brand-name or generic product. Prices can also vary significantly between different pharmacies and online retailers.

How much does docusate calcium typically cost?


The cost of docusate calcium can range from approximately $10 to $30 for a bottle of 100 capsules, with higher strengths or specialized formulations potentially costing more. For instance, a 100 mg, 100-count bottle of generic docusate calcium might be found in the $10 to $20 range, while other forms could be priced higher.

Where can I buy docusate calcium?


Docusate calcium is widely available over-the-counter at most pharmacies, including large chains and independent drugstores. It can also be purchased from online pharmacies and general retailers.

Are there different strengths or forms of docusate calcium?


Yes, docusate calcium is available in various forms, including capsules, liquid solutions, and suppositories, typically in strengths such as 50 mg or 100 mg. The formulation and strength can influence the price.

Does insurance cover docusate calcium?


As an over-the-counter medication, docusate calcium is generally not covered by health insurance plans unless prescribed by a doctor for a specific medical condition and dispensed as a prescription. It is often an affordable option even without insurance.

What are the alternatives to docusate calcium for constipation?


Other common over-the-counter laxatives include bulk-forming agents like psyllium, osmotic laxatives such as polyethylene glycol and magnesium citrate, and stimulant laxatives like senna or bisacodyl. The choice of alternative may depend on the individual's needs and medical history.
